
Treat the sofa. If your dog had fleas they and their eggs could be anywhere - soft furnishings, rugs, the dog's bedding. Obviously, also check your dog. I'd ask the vet if you find fleas before giving her another dose of something.
I believe Frontline make two version of the topical ointment. One will just kill adult fleas and the other version (contains S-methoprene) kills adult fleas and their eggs. The latter is obviously better, since it prevents the eggs already on your dog from hatching and jumping off her coat onto something more hospitable (like you or your sofa).
If you have carpeting you can put a flea collar or a flea powder in the dust bag or canister. It will kill the flea eggs and any live fleas you pick up. Of course, if you have a Dyson or other make without dust bags the best thing to do is empty it after every use.
